Output e5fd8628da41242061ada14fe8595df5003441cb6774ea9eace0dbea0120bc16:1

value
17584248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b8b181cb70b63c5d36843355744fed19816d42c OP_EQUAL
address
35fFcE4oLDoZPUnCqcH36grXQRe4UYzR1W
transaction
e5fd8628da41242061ada14fe8595df5003441cb6774ea9eace0dbea0120bc16
spent
true